[quote]A display of photographer Graham Watson's Tour de France imagery is scheduled to open July 1st at the County Hall Gallery in London. The exhibition celebrates Watson three decades of photographing the Tour and will feature 200 selected images. "Basically, it's 30 years since I took my first images; of the 1977 Tour de France," Watson says about the significance of the show. "I then sold an image of Eddy Merckx to Cycling Weekly that autumn, which formed the foundation of my cycling photography career."

The gallery's address is County Hall Gallery, Riverside, London S.E.1 - across the River Thames from Big Ben and the British Houses of Parliament and 50-metres from the London Eye. The exhibit runs from 1st July to 9th July, from 10.30am to 6.30pm and the entry is free.
